We are looking for people who can deliver outstanding customer service and an efficient housing management service to older adults living within our Retirement Living Scheme in Meriden.

Driven by our vision for everyone to have the opportunity to have a place that they can call home, we’re a leading social housing provider with a mission to deliver good quality, affordable homes to people who need them most.

We manage around 31,500 homes, serving 65,000 customers across our portfolio of affordable properties for general rent, and shared ownership and sale, as well as specialist accommodation, and  an ambitious house-building programme.

We’re looking for like-minded people to join our team of over 800 colleagues who embody our values of being ethical, ambitious, passionate, agile and commercial, as well as people who want to make a difference and transform people’s lives.

The role:

  • Deliveringcustomer-centric, outcome focussed support services, helping customers to sustain their tenancy and lead an independent life.
  • Conducting service reviews, including health and safety and fire safety checks.
  • Completing needs and risk assessments, sign-ups and resident inductions, initiating tenancy terminations and supporting the promotion of vacant dwellings.
  • Acting as mediator between Stonewater and customers on issues such as rent, housing nad neighbours.
  • Supporting the promotion and take-up of new and existing services.

The ideal candidate:

  • Experience of delivering housing and tenancy management services.
  • Excellent communication, customer service  and interpersonal skills.
  • Literacy and numerical skills, including an ability to work with figures and spreadsheets.
  • Excellent organisational skills with an ability to manage workloads and meet deadlines.
  • An understanding of the support needs and health issues faced by older adults
  • A flexible attitude to work. You will be expected to work flexibly including some evenings, Bank Holidays and weekends if required and will attend training and meetings at other offices.
